Top Fantasy Gacha Games in 2025

GamePlatformsFantasy Highlights
Genshin ImpactPC, PS4/5, iOS, AndroidRich elemental magic, multi-nation kingdoms, exploration
AFK JourneyPC, iOS, AndroidClassic fantasy land, idle RPG with tactical team-building
ArknightsPC, iOS, AndroidDystopian fantasy, unique races, powerful magic operators
Epic SevenPC, iOS, AndroidAnime-style world, knights, faeries, and legendary beasts
Guardian TalesiOS, Android, PC (emulated)Pixel fantasy, dark lords, fairy tales, and adventure humor
EversoulPC, iOS, AndroidCollectible spirits, magical realms, relationship stories
Idle HeroesiOS, Android, PC (emulated)Classic fantasy heroes, monsters, evolving legendary roster
Summoners WarPC, iOS, AndroidMonster catching, elemental dungeons, dragon battles
DislytePC, iOS, AndroidMythic beings with a modern edge
Langrisser MobileiOS, AndroidSword-and-sorcery grid tactics, crossover with classic tales
Tales of CrestoriaiOS, Android“Tales” anime fantasy, heroic journeys, magic-wielding friends

Why Fantasy Gacha Games Stand Out

Magical Worlds & Lore
Explore mystical regions, from enchanted forests and flying cities in Genshin Impact to the spirit-filled realms of Eversoul. These worlds invite nonstop discovery and adventure.

Epic Summons & Heroes
Build your ultimate team from knights, dragons, sorcerers, and more. Many games feature evolving heroes and equipment, magical skills, and legendary forms, Epic Seven and Idle Heroes are fan favorites for collectors.

Deep Quests & Storylines
Fantasy gachas shine with story-rich campaigns, side quests, and event arcs bringing new challenges, lore, and exclusive units. Banner events often introduce powerful heroes or villains from fabled legends.

Vibrant Art & Atmosphere
Expect stunning anime-style visuals, gorgeous landscapes, and exciting magical effects, ideal for immersing yourself in endless fantasy.

Quick Tips for Fantasy Fans

  • Save currency for banners with iconic magical heroes or elemental legendaries.
  • Explore side dungeons and world events for top-tier gear and bonus summons.
  • Get involved in seasonal events for rare fantasy skins and unique storylines.
